491.2oops, the Big Mac should be 570, not 590 ...ANT::ZARLENGAradios pumpin' to the way she walkedWed Aug 09 1989 07:4713
.1>    Should think they're about the same.

    	Big Mac					590
    	Chef Salad w/ 1000 island dressing	620
    
    	There are only 230 in the salad itself, and 390 in the packet
    of salad dressing.
    
    	Fat can sneak in when you're not looking.
